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40793478 2304 6981 19094
54 90427355531
54 90427355531
6454592 91983 123955693
All about undefined
Interested in learning more?
54 90427355531
6454592 91983 123955693
See more
86722074 3330202321
43456396 0361580 841508904 166
See more
952 5222479 22886
60 61 283
See more